As a general principle, sequels are a bad idea. Speed 2: Cruise Control is a good example. What was Willem Dafoe thinking? And I can’t even bring myself to ponder what happened to The Matrix series.

There are, of course, some notable exceptions: Aliens; Dark Knight and the Bourne films to name but a few.

And this is definitely one too.

The NSPCC Dream Auction returns with the chance for you to bid for some truly unique experiences.

It’s an eBay charity auction with all the proceeds going towards fighting the abuse of children and some of the lots are mind-blowing.

Get bidding now and make this sequel a success.
